K Matrix Square Root Variables in K2 Model

Use this field to specify the variables containing columns of the square root of the K matrix in the K2 model, which is a matrix containing kinship coefficients computed using either the Relationship Matrix or K Matrix Compression processes.

This matrix is used as a random effect in the model.

Note: If a Pedigree ID Variable in K2 Model is not specified, this matrix should contain the same number of variables as observations in the input data set. When a pedigree ID variable is specified, this matrix should have the same number of variables as the number of individuals in the largest pedigree in the data set.

To Specify the K Matrix Square Root Variables in the K2 Model:

8 Specify the Input SAS Data Set.

All of the variables in the specified input data set are displayed in the Available Variables field.

8 Examine the list of available variables.
8 Highlight the variable(s) listing columns of the square root of the K matrix for the K2 model. To select multiple variables at once, hold down while left-clicking.
8 Click to add the highlighted variable(s) to the K Matrix Square Root Variables in K2 Model field.
